    1. Puppy quest is more of trap. It is nice to open location, but might as well let him die. Who is more valuable your character or puppy?
    2.Well, if you have healing (as priest) it would be better to activate druid quest instead. By design you get access to either carpenter or druid quest (depending on which NPc you speak first.)
    3.Well, if you have not done other stuff (in this case Arena) out of order, dwarven elder would not assign you random monster kills.
    4. No idea... but in general there are no teleports between levels. The late game has one shortcut to surface (not from dwarftown).
    5. Well, there are some messages indicating significance of CoC (Caverns of Chaos). For unspoiled player I think idea is that you go down CoC untill you meet obstacle, then you figure it out and do quests allowing to go deeper. Spoiled ones clear that stuff in advance.
    6. Adom guidebook has some basic ideas on how game should progress, Steam has guide on dealing with elemental temples, some classes has guides (adomguides.blogspot).
    7. Down CoC untill you can't anymore? Also there is lots of optional places - rift/library, frost queen, high king dungeons, random dungeons... It is not world on the rails...
    8. look at 6.
    9. "(", ")" create character log files. Steam probably has a way to do proper screenshot in overlay.
    10. Towns have guaranteed feature in shops. Altars are generated randomly (except temples and dwarftown).
    11. Don't Id everything? Weapons can be checked via price in shop and most of armor can be ignored [once you have a passable item in that slot].

    - F12 takes screenshot in steam.
    - Berkserker quest is more like you are done with it when you are done with it. I usually just later return and check if I've done it or not. I don't go Infinite Dungeon to kill monsters.
    - There is several place you can go in world map. I recommend checking Putrid, Moldy, Shadowy random dungeons first. Then you can try Sinister random dungeon, it's a bit harder than first 3. Ancient and Crumbling random dungeons are for little higher level characters.
    - Ice Queen Domain can be tried as well. Be wary! Not the easiest place.
    - Or simply go deeper in CoC and keep doing Thundrrar quests in dwarf town by 'C'hatting with him and asking him about "Quest"
    - Do everything possible before trying Tower of Eternal Flame. Because it's one of the hardest places in game.

    Well, you got lizard quest... cause dwarven elder can't assign you Arena quest - since you done it. Solution don't do Arena to early.

    I don't know what your char looks like. But at lv17 it's normal to do high kings (NW through minor mountains), dark forge (low center) and ice queen stuff. All areas are pretty much well described in guidebook.

    DF is done for armor/weapons, ice queen for xp and high kings essentially needs to be done eventually. The best gear at this point is good shield and kickass weapon... Guaranteed kickassish weapon is at the end of dwarven elder quest line... which.. well, don't do Arena to early.
